Cultural Diversity in Photography

Photography is one of the most popular mediums to explore the concept of cultural diversity. It can capture the essence of cultures, the beauty of different landscapes, and the soul of people.

One example of cultural diversity photography is the work of photographer Jimmy Nelson. His project, “Before They Pass Away,” documents vanishing indigenous communities around the world. The pictures he takes give a glimpse into the unique and fascinating cultures that can disappear due to globalization.

Another example of cultural diversity photography is the work of National Geographic photographers. Through their lenses, they capture the beauty and uniqueness of different cultures around the world. Their work inspires us to appreciate and respect the diversity of humanity.
